KILLING TIME is for fans of suspense, horror, and paranormal thrillers.

BOOK DESCRIPTION:
Tick-tock… time to die.

Kristen thought she had nothing. No friends. A mother who bounced her from boarding school to boarding school. A father she never knew.

Then she got the call. “It’s after you, sweetie. Still after you.” Now, accompanied by the local bad boy, Kristen has only a few hours to discover the truth. To uncover secrets that have remained hidden for decades. To find out why her father abandoned her, her mother rejected her.

And how the clocks are killing them all. One at a time, those involved in the mystery are receiving the gift of a clock that counts backward to the witching hour. And when it rings at midnight, a ghostly power—and a fate truly worse than death—is unleashed.

Kristen has to hurry.

Because the otherworldly power is still out there. Coming for her.

And it’s only a matter of time.

One of the most versatile writers around, Michaelbrent Collings is an internationally bestselling novelist, produced screenwriter, and multiple Bram Stoker Award finalist. While he is best known for horror (and is one of the most successful indie horror authors in the United States), he has also written bestselling thriller, fantasy, science fiction, mystery, humor, young adult, and middle grade works, and Western Romance.

In addition to being a bestselling novelist, Michaelbrent has also received critical acclaim: he is the only person who has ever been a finalist for a Bram Stoker Award, a Dragon Award, a RONE Award, and a Whitney award: and he and his work have been reviewed and/or featured on everything from Publishers Weekly to Scream Magazine to NPR. He is also a frequent guest at comic cons and on writing podcasts like Six Figure Authors, The Creative Penn, and Writing Excuses.

Collings generously provided many of his e-books at no cost. I chose to first try Scavenger Hunt before purchasing any of the other books. I enjoyed it and gave it 4 stars. Taking advantage of this offer, I downloaded several more. Killing Time is my second Collings book. This felt like a badly executed YA horror novel. The story started out well but quickly took a turn for the worse. The plot is full of holes that are left unanswered and after finishing, I am still asking “but why?”. It does kind of come together in the end and I probably would have given it a 3-star rating (although I did not enjoy it and forced myself to finish) had it not been for the numerous grammatical errors. These errors break the continuity and takes me out of the story. With it already feeling incomplete, constantly hitting poorly structured sentences just solidified this perception. Yes, I could fill in the blanks and figure it out but that’s the author’s job. A few instances can be ignored but constant errors scream of laziness to me. Be it the fault of the editor or the author, I don’t know and I don’t care. Examples – Gerald Norton was thinner than now. (page 169) - But that was not arrested the gaze. (page 187). – Kristen’s index finger into her eye. (page 151) – The was sitting in a high-backed chair next to the computer desk. (page 163) – I didn’t start highlighting these errors until later in the book and I simply couldn’t take anymore but they were scattered throughout. In the end, I’ll leave it that the story was little more than ok and the grammar was appalling.
